Написание PICAXE BASIC Code - часть 2

C++ Minecraft Cheat (Memory Hacking) (June 2019).

$config[ads_text] not found
Anonim

Написание PICAXE BASIC Code - часть 2


Рекомендуемый уровень

начинающий

Предпосылки

Написание PICAXE BASIC Code - часть 1

В этой статье представлены следующие команды: команда wait, переменные общего назначения, команда символов и директива #no_data. В первой части представлены команды с высоким, низким, паузой и goto, директива #picaxe и концепция меток. Прежде чем продолжить эту статью, потребуется выполнить часть 1 этой серии. В части 1 приведены подробные сведения о конструкции испытательной цепи кодирования PA-08M2, которая необходима для завершения этой статьи.

Кроме того, существует новая версия PICAXE Editor 6; по состоянию на 3 сентября 2015 года последняя версия 6.0.8.1. Эта версия все еще находится в бета-тестировании и исправляет некоторые проблемы в предыдущей версии. Вы должны загрузить и установить его перед продолжением: следуйте инструкциям здесь.

Светофоры

В конце первой части вам предложили задачу взять информацию в этой статье и использовать ее для написания кода, чтобы светодиоды соответствовали шаблону освещения на одной стороне светофора, как описано ниже.

• Зеленые вспышки включаются и выключаются 10 раз в течение 10 секунд.

• Зеленый на 20 секунд, затем выключен.

• Желтый на 3 секунды, затем выключен.

• Красный на 27 секунд, затем выключен.

• Повторяйте непрерывно.

Вам было рекомендовано, чтобы никакие аппаратные изменения в цепи тестирования кодирования PA-08M2 не требовались.

Если вам удастся справиться с этим вызовом, вы получили высокую оценку; если нет, не волнуйтесь, просто загрузите приведенный ниже код, запрограммируйте PICAXE 08M2 в своей тестовой цепи кодирования и посмотрите, как он работает. Если у вас есть проблема, проверьте все следующие возможности.

• Ваш кабель программирования подключен от ПК к цепи тестирования кодирования.

• Правильный COM-порт выбран на панели настроек рабочего места PE6.

• PICAXE-08M2 выбран на панели настроек рабочего места PE6.

• Питание подключено к макету схемы кодирования.

Скачать код

Программный анализ

Код, который вы написали, может иметь некоторое сходство с загруженной программой, которая, хотя и длинная, по-прежнему довольно проста. Все последующие ссылки на цвет текста основаны на значениях по умолчанию, используемых в PE6.

Строки с 1 по 13, воспроизведенные ниже, полностью состоят из комментариев и находятся в «зеленом» тексте. Как вы знаете, комментарии никогда не загружаются в PICAXE и включаются исключительно в интересах людей, читающих код. Взятые полностью, эти строки образуют «заголовок», в котором содержится информация о коде. Заголовок в вашем коде будет структурирован в соответствии с вашими предпочтениями и должен содержать большую часть той же информации.